我已将Eclipse(Mars)使用的工作区复制到新目录(使用tar来确保权限/所有权完好无损)。一切都运行良好,除了eGit指向原始工作区中的旧.gitconfig文件。例如:
lapply
...当使用“workspace2”时,我转到“Git Repositories”视图,右键单击存储库并选择“Properties”,“Configuration”“location”指向“workspace1”,更改分支将改变“workspace1”。位置路径类似于“/Users/alex/workspaces/workspace1/project1/.git/config”,我只需将“workspace1”更改为“workspace2”。
我需要做的就是更改路径,但我无法在任何配置文件中找到此文本(使用grep),并且该值在对话框中是只读的。有谁知道我怎么能改变路径?这样做比断开/重新连接等更容易。
非常感谢提前! 欢呼声,
亚历
答案 0 :(得分:2)
Git Reposititories 视图的配置存储在" /Users/alex/workspaces/workspace1/.metadata/.plugins/org.eclipse.core.runtime/.settings/org中.eclipse.egit.core.prefs&#34 ;.但是,我认为直接编辑它并不是一个好主意。
我建议您使用EGit函数更改路径:
Team -> Disconnect
Remove Reposititory from View
Team -> Share Project...